Ride1Up Unveils Upgraded LMT’D V2 Electric Commuter Bike

San Diego-based electric bike retailer, Ride1Up, celebrated for offering exceptional value in commuter e-bikes, has broadened its product range over the past year. Expanding into new categories such as electric mopeds and adventure e-bikes, the company has continued to innovate while solidifying its presence in the road market. The latest addition to its lineup is the upgraded Ride1Up LMT’D V2, a refreshed version of its popular commuter-focused model.

The Ride1Up LMT’D V2 retains the core features that made its predecessor a hit among riders but introduces several key upgrades. One of the most significant enhancements is the inclusion of a new torque sensor, aimed at delivering a more comfortable and responsive pedaling experience.

While the bike still features a throttle, favored by many e-bike riders in the US for conquering hills or cruising effortlessly, the addition of a torque sensor ensures that pedaling feels natural and efficient.

A handlebar-mounted color display allows riders to easily navigate through different pedal assist power levels and monitor essential riding metrics such as distance, speed, and battery level. The bike is powered by a 48V 14Ah Reention battery with Samsung battery cells, offering a range of 30-50 miles (50-80 km) depending on the mode of assist.

Classified as a Class 3 e-bike, the Ride1Up LMT’D V2 can reach speeds of up to 28 mph (45 km/h) with pedal assist, while the throttle provides speeds of up to 20 mph (32 km/h). The 750W continuous-rated rear hub motor ensures ample power delivery for both high-speed and hill-climbing rides.

Equipped with dual-piston Tektro hydraulic disc brakes with 180mm rotors, the LMT’D V2 offers reliable stopping power and a nearly maintenance-free braking system. The bike also features WTB GROOV-E 27.5″x2.4″ tires designed for electric bikes, offering a smooth ride and enhanced durability.

Additional features include LED lighting, a Shimano 8-speed transmission for those who prefer pedaling, and rack mounts for added cargo-carrying capacity. The Ride1Up LMT’D V2 is available in both step-over and step-through models, each offered in three color options: Brushed Copper, Charcoal Satin, and Snowstorm.

Priced at US $1,595, the Ride1Up LMT’D V2 is now available on the company’s website, with deliveries expected to commence next week. Riders can expect a blend of performance, comfort, and value in this latest offering from Ride1Up.
